'Even thinking about Coldplay I get tearful': Denise Lewis's honest playlist

For Denise Lewis, the power ballad that reduces her to tears is not a surprise, given her own personal history of overcoming adversity. Her playlist is a testament to her eclectic taste in music and the memories attached to each song.

The Queen classic Bohemian Rhapsody was among the first songs she fell in love with at nursery school. It's a nod to her early introduction to iconic music that has stood the test of time. The song also appears on her "first single I bought" list, alongside Ring My Bell by Anita Ward and Whitney Houston's I Have Nothing, both of which showcase her enthusiasm for upbeat tracks.

Lewis's love for karaoke is evident in her choice of a-ha's Take On Me and Whitney Houston's One Moment In Time. The latter song holds personal significance as it fueled her Olympic ambitions during the 1988 games. It serves as an empowering anthem that continues to motivate her today.

Other notable entries include Savage by Megan Thee Stallion, which provides a morning boost of confidence, and Hold on to Your Table, an upbeat track that embodies Lewis's feisty personality.

Coldplay is where things get emotional for Denise. Even thinking about the song "The Scientist" reduces her to tears, reflecting her deep connection with the music. Perhaps it's the poignant lyrics or the nostalgic value attached to seeing Coldplay live that makes this particular song so impactful.

In an interesting twist, Lewis has a love-hate relationship with Merry Xmas Everybody by Slade, while revealing that she secretly admires Céline Dion's My Heart Will Go On. Such complexities demonstrate her ability to appreciate multiple facets of music without shying away from her honest opinions.
